What is SEO?

Search Engine Optimization improves website traffic to a particular web page through search engines. It helps businesses get a filtered audience to their domain to enhance efficiency. SEO is about knowing what kind of words the audience uses to search with and connecting it to the product or service.

SEO is used to work on three aspects:

  • Traffic quality
  • Traffic quantity
  • Organic search results

This means organically maximizing the number of genuinely interested people in what the business is selling and not overspending on advertisements.

Why Is SEO Important?

Now that you have a basic idea of SEO, think about your search behavior on Google. How often do you click the third page in the search results? Hardly ever.

You usually click one of the first three links that pop up. This happens because the first three links are Search Engine Optimized and have organically increased their search ranking by using specific keywords.

Now you’re probably thinking, “Sometimes I see ads too — what’s that all about?”

You’re right. Search results are also promoted through ads. Ad spending for Search Advertising reached about $182,886m in 2021 and will continue to grow paired with Search Engine Optimized content. It brings in more users who buy from the company rather than running after numbers that don’t translate into sales.

Best Tools for Keyword Search

If you’re thinking to incorporate SEO into your marketing mix, here are some resources you can use:

  • Google Keyword Planner — One of the most accurate
  • Soovle — Keywords available from YouTube, Amazon, Google, Bing, and more
  • Jaaxy — Additional support data on every keyword

5 Tips for SEO Beginners

Some other tips that you should consider are:

  • Creating High-Quality Content — Add authentic information and avoid misleading.
  • Using Google Analytics — Track and analyze website traffic for better personalization.
  • Optimizing Images with Keywords — Add keywords in image descriptions and alt texts.
  • Keep Learning — Read more about digital engagement trends.
  • Play The Faux Consumer — What keywords would you look for when searching?
